Going Down

A man followed a woman onto an elevator at an office building in Chicago, Ill., and, when the doors closed, pushed her against the wall and put his hand under her clothes to grope her. She managed to hit the Emergency button on the panel, and the man fled when the doors opened. A suspect was quickly caught. In addition to the victim and a witness identifying Robert Skipper, 29, as the perpetrator, when the woman was brought in to identify Skipper in a lineup, before she could say anything, he did. “That’s her!” he exclaimed — and his statement was caught by the bodycams of officers in the room. “That’s the one I got! I stalk my prey.” The judge in the case denied Skipper bail, and he is being held on felony counts of criminal sexual abuse, attempted criminal sexual assault, and unlawful restraint. (RC/Chicago Sun Times) ...Though it’s unclear they’ll be able to prove he has much restraint.
